Glyco‐Nanogels for Modulating Pseudomonas aeruginosa Biofilm
Nanogels presenting α‐galactose and β‐fucose can significantly alter Pseudomonas aeruginosa biofilm dynamics through their interaction with lectins. Application timing is crucial: pre‐treatment reduces biofilm, while treatment after biofilm initiation increases biomass.
